Font Pairing Tips for Designers
To maximize the visual appeal of Breathe Sophia, consider pairing it with complementary fonts. For instance, combining it with a modern sans serif font like Montserrat or Open Sans creates a balanced look for captions or body text. If you want a more editorial feel, try matching it with a classic serif font such as Georgia or Times New Roman.
This approach ensures that your designs remain readable while still standing out. It also allows you to maintain a clear visual hierarchy, guiding the viewer’s eye from the main headline to supporting details seamlessly.

Licensing and Usage Best Practices
Before using Breathe Sophia in client projects, ads, or commercial templates, always review the font’s licensing terms. Many premium fonts require specific permissions for certain uses, so understanding these details ensures compliance and avoids legal issues down the line.
As a marketing specialist, I recommend keeping a library of approved fonts and their usage guidelines to streamline your workflow and ensure all design assets meet both creative and legal standards.
